#ifndef PORTMACRO_H | |
#define PORTMACRO_H | |
/*----------------------------------------------------------- | |
* Port specific definitions. | |
* | |
* The settings in this file configure FreeRTOS correctly for the | |
* given hardware and compiler. | |
* | |
* These settings should not be altered. | |
*----------------------------------------------------------- | |
*/ | |
/* Type definitions. */ | |
#define portCHAR char | |
#define portFLOAT float | |
#define portDOUBLE double | |
#define portLONG long | |
#define portSHORT int | |
#define portSTACK_TYPE unsigned char | |
#define portBASE_TYPE char | |
#if( configUSE_16_BIT_TICKS == 1 ) | |
typedef unsigned portSHORT portTickType; | |
#define portMAX_DELAY ( portTickType ) 0xffff | |
#else | |
typedef unsigned portLONG portTickType; | |
#define portMAX_DELAY ( portTickType ) 0xffffffff | |
#endif | |
/*-----------------------------------------------------------*/ | |
/* Hardware specifics. */ | |
#define portBYTE_ALIGNMENT 1 | |
#define portGLOBAL_INT_ENABLE_BIT 0x80 | |
#define portSTACK_GROWTH 1 | |
#define portTICK_RATE_MS ( ( portTickType ) 1000 / configTICK_RATE_HZ ) | |
/*-----------------------------------------------------------*/ | |
/* Critical section management. */ | |
#define portDISABLE_INTERRUPTS() INTCONbits.GIEH = 0; | |
#define portENABLE_INTERRUPTS() INTCONbits.GIEH = 1; | |
/* Push the INTCON register onto the stack, then disable interrupts. */ | |
#define portENTER_CRITICAL() POSTINC1 = INTCON; \ | |
INTCONbits.GIEH = 0; | |
/* Retrieve the INTCON register from the stack, and enable interrupts | |
if they were saved as being enabled. Don't modify any other bits | |
within the INTCON register as these may have lagitimately have been | |
modified within the critical region. */ | |
#define portEXIT_CRITICAL() _asm \ | |
MOVF POSTDEC1, 1, 0 \ | |
_endasm \ | |
if( INDF1 & portGLOBAL_INT_ENABLE_BIT ) \ | |
{ \ | |
portENABLE_INTERRUPTS(); \ | |
} | |
/*-----------------------------------------------------------*/ | |
/* Task utilities. */ | |
extern void vPortYield( void ); | |
#define portYIELD() vPortYield() | |
/*-----------------------------------------------------------*/ | |
/* Task function macros as described on the FreeRTOS.org WEB site. */ | |
#define portTASK_FUNCTION_PROTO( vFunction, pvParameters ) void vFunction( void *pvParameters ) | |
#define portTASK_FUNCTION( vFunction, pvParameters ) void vFunction( void *pvParameters ) | |
/*-----------------------------------------------------------*/ | |
/* Required by the kernel aware debugger. */ | |
#ifdef __DEBUG | |
#define portREMOVE_STATIC_QUALIFIER | |
#endif | |
#define portNOP() _asm \ | |
NOP \ | |
_endasm | |
#endif /* PORTMACRO_H */ | |
